Board Committee Structure 4.7
A committee is a Board committee only if its existence and
charge come from the Board and its work is intended to support the Board’s
work, whether or not Board members serve on the committee. The only Board committees
are those established by the Board. Unless otherwise indicated, a committee
ceases to exist as soon as its task is complete.
Board committees will have the following structure:
1) Charge: A
description of the purpose of the committee.
2) Membership: The names
of the individuals appointed to the committee.
3) Reporting
Schedule: The timetable for reporting progress to the Board.
4)
Term: A description of how or when the
committee ends.
